The NSW Amateur Championships are National and World Ranking Events.

 

The Championship is open to amateur golfers who hold a current Australian or overseas equivalent GC handicap that does not exceed 5.4 for men and 12.4 for women. Club Champions from NSW Golf Clubs are eligible to enter the Championship if their GA handicap is greater than 5.4.

Field Size

The maximum field size for the Championship will be 264 players (176 men, 88 women). In the event of entry applications exceeding the number of places available in the Championship, applications from those higher handicap competitors not exempt from a handicap ballot will be decided by a handicap ballot. Unsuccessful applicants will be informed without delay and given the opportunity to compete if withdrawals subsequently occur. Monies received from balloted entrants, who do not subsequently
compete, will be refunded in entirety.

 

NSW Medal
The NSW Medal is played over two courses. It is two rounds of 18-holes stroke play for the men’s field, played over two days. The field changes venue for their second round. The winner of the 36 holes stroke play section of the Championship is the winner of the NSW Medal.

 

NSW Strokeplay
The NSW Strokeplay is played over two courses. It is two rounds of 18-holes stroke play for the women’s field, played over two days. The field is divided between the two venues for the first day’s play with players changing venues for their second round. The winner of the 36 holes stroke play section of the Championship is the winner of the NSW Strokeplay Championship.

NSW Amateur Championships
The leading 32 players from the NSW Medal (who have nominated to play in the NSW Amateur) will be eligible to compete in the Men’s NSW Amateur Championship Match Play, with each match played over 18-holes other than the Final which is played over 36-holes. The match play is seeded with ties determined by lot.

 

The leading 16 players from the NSW Strokeplay (who have nominated to play in the NSW Amateur) will be eligible to compete in the Women’s NSW Amateur Championship Match Play, with each match played over 18-holes other than the Final which is played over 36-holes. The match play is seeded with ties determined by lot.

 

NSW Open Exemptions

NSW Medal and Men’s NSW Amateur Champions receive exemptions into the Men’s NSW Open.

 

NSW Strokeplay and Women’s NSW Amateur Champions receive exemptions into the Women’s NSW Open.
